    Battery Replacement

    If your key fob does not unlock or start your Lexus then you might need to replace its battery. This is a straightforward process that can be completed at home or in a dealership. It is recommended that you read the owner's manual before starting. The exact steps differ depending on the model and year.

    Make sure your hands are clean and dry. The introduction of moisture to the fob could cause damage or rust to your new battery. Open the key fob by pressing the release button on the side. Take off the mechanical key blade, if it is present. Remove the cover plate with the flat screwdriver or any other flat tool. Take the old battery off, and then place a new CR1632 battery in place with its positive side facing upwards. Then snap the fob back in place and you're good to go!

    It is possible to find this kind of battery in many hardware stores, auto part shops, and a few locksmiths. The price can vary depending on the manufacturer and location.     Keys Replacement

    It's possible to replace your key if it's not working properly or you've lost it. You can get into your car with a new key or remote. You can purchase one from the dealership or from an automotive locksmith. The key must be programmed to work with your Lexus. The cost of this service depends on the model of your car as well as the type of key you own (fobs, remotes, intelligent fobs, or regular "push-to-start" keys).

    lexus key fob replacement cost Smart Keys have radio frequency identification chips that communicate with the car. You can open your doors and trunk by pressing the button. The chip can also be used to activate the alarm system and also start the car's engine.

    A smart key or key fob usually can last for a lengthy period before it has to be replaced. However, repeated use or exposure to cold or heat could affect its performance. In addition the key may be dropped or damaged.

    Keyless Entry System Replacement

    Lexus fobs differ from traditional car keys. They feature sophisticated hardware which communicates with the vehicle to open or lock doors, or to turn on the push button ignition. The key fobs, as such aren't as easy to use as traditional car keys and could occasionally not function as intended. There are a few solutions you might try if your fob isn't working.

    The simplest option is to replace the battery. These can be found at any hardware store, online retailer, or big-box retailer for an affordable price. They are a quick fix. Follow the steps in your owner's manual or even on YouTube.

    If the battery replacement doesn't solve the issue, you might have an even more serious issue that requires expert assistance or more thorough work. Contact your dealer, or an authorized locksmith service to change keys and fobs for the best results. Be sure to have all of your vital documents ready prior to calling including the title certificate and registration card. Also, make sure to have proof of insurance as well as VIN numbers.

    It is simple to replace the battery in your Lexus key fob. Push the release button located on the left side to release the key blade made of metal. Slide the flathead screwdriver tip into the space that used be occupied by the mechanical emergency key blade. After removing the cover plate remove the battery with the screwdriver. Replace the battery with the new CR2032 Lithium battery.

    You can extend the life of your keyfob battery by keeping it away from devices that produce magnetic fields. This includes laptops, televisions, and chargers for cell phones. Do not place the fob in close proximity to objects made of metal, which can generate static charges.
